Contract Description
Per solicitation dated 06/17/2026, Awardee to provide all labor, supervision and equipment to pickup and transport and dispose of hazardous materials in two locations for Coast Guard Sector St. Petersburg, FL, per provided SOW. Base POP: 21 July 2026 - 20 July 2027
